About the event
11:00 am – Arrive on bike!
Join PBOT for the Earth Day Community Bike Ride from Colonel Summers Park to Laurelhurst Park. Ride the Neighborhood Greenways, Portland’s quiet, slow streets that are prioritized for walking, biking, and rolling. More information at the Portland Bureau of Transportation.
Noon – Let the Celebration Begin
Enjoy free food provided by Milk Crate Kitchen and music by DJ Pyum. Participate in a free seed exchange to find something new to grow. Explore local resources from the City and community, such as leave as no trace, recycling, and green roofs. Meet the Mayor’s unconfirmed appointments to the Sustainability and Climate Commission. And more!
1:30 pm – Earth Day Remarks from City Leaders
Hear from Mayor Keith Wilson, Councilor Steve Novick, and Chief Sustainability Officer Vivian Satterfield about how the city and community can come together as one to deepen our commitment to protect the planet and its people.
2:00 pm – Family Fun with Nikki Brown Clown & Tree Walk with Urban Forestry!
Enjoy laughter and joy with Earth Day-themed entertainment from Nikki the Brown Clown. Perfect for little ones and families!
Go on a tree walk with Urban Forestry through Laurelhurst Park. Although books and online resources are useful tools for identifying trees, the best and most memorable way to learn about trees is by seeing them up close and in person. A tree walk lets you not only see trees but also learn about them through touch and smell.
